TWO men have been rushed to hospital following a two vehicle crash on the A7 between Galashiels and Stow.

Emergency service teams were called to the scene, near the Bowland junction, after two vans collided at around 1.30pm this afternoon.

And it has been confirmed a man in his 20s and another in his 40s have been taken to Borders General Hospital for treatment, after becoming trapped.

A spokesperson for the Scottish Ambulance Service said: “We received a call at 1340 to attend a road traffic accident near the B710 junction with the A7 north of Galashiels.

"We dispatched two ambulances and a special operations team to the scene and transported two male patients – one in his 20s, the other in his 40s – to the Borders General Hospital.”

A Police Scotland spokesperson added: "Two vans collided on the A7 at around 1.30pm.

"The drivers were trapped and it took around one hour to get them out."
